Yvette Nicole Brown has hit a unique career milestone after starring in Pixar’s latest hit “Inside Out 2.” This sunny sequel to Disney and Pixar’s 2015 blockbuster has shone a spotlight on Brown’s varied and illustrious career. Her résumé now includes significant roles in projects from all four of the major Disney-owned studios: Disney, Pixar, Lucasfilm, and Marvel.

This milestone was pointed out on social platform X, where it was revealed that Brown is the first to lend her talents to projects from each of these iconic brands. Her diverse roles include a cameo in “Avengers: Endgame,” Aunt Sarah in Disney+’s “Lady and the Tramp,” Lieutenant Valeria in “Lego Star Wars: The Freemaker Adventures,” and now Coach Roberts in “Inside Out 2.” Brown’s enthusiastic response on social media—exclaiming “What?! That’s EPIC!!!”—sums up this remarkable achievement. Humorously, she likened this milestone to achieving her personal “EGOT” for the world of Disney, dubbing it the “DMPL.”

So, who exactly is Yvette Nicole Brown? Many remember her early breakout roles in shows like “Girlfriends” and “The Big House,” but she truly became a household name as Helen Dubois in Nickelodeon’s “Drake & Josh.” From there, her career flourished with appearances in beloved sitcoms such as “That’s So Raven,” “The Office,” and as Shirley Bennett in “Community.” Brown’s voice has been heard in animated series such as “Pound Puppies,” “Family Guy,” and “DC Super Hero Girls.” Her versatility and magnetic presence have made her a staple across many genres.

“Inside Out 2” picks up a few years after its predecessor, diving into the tumultuous world of Riley’s adolescence as she navigates puberty and the challenges of a weekend hockey camp. The familiar emotions of Joy, Sadness, Fear, Anger, and Disgust are joined by a host of new ones, including Anxiety, Envy, Embarrassment, and Ennui, creating a riotous but heartfelt adventure into Riley’s growing and complicated mind.

The film has not only continued the enchanting storytelling of its predecessor but has also shattered box office records. With a massive $295 million opening weekend, “Inside Out 2” is already closing in on the $400 million mark. Domestically, the film has quickly earned $205 million, surpassing the first movie’s opening numbers by over $60 million.
